25 is the vanilla cap in Origins, 35 in Awakening. You need to override exptable_gxa.gda, which extends the original exptable.gda, assuming that is the root cause of the issue.

Problem SOLVED...
Solution 1: Thing is I was trying to expand both LVL cap and the amount of experience to get to lvl 50 which around 600k... I re-arrange the actual experience progression so with "353501" which is the Awakening cap you'll hit lvl 50. (This option will make it compatible with other mods)
Solution 2: will be just editing properties.gda (which I totally forgot until I remake exptable -.-) and set experience max to whichever where are trying to get... but may create conflict with toher "properties editing" mods.
